The BZD27C200PHRUG belongs to the category of voltage regulator diodes. It is primarily used for voltage regulation and transient voltage suppression in electronic circuits.
The BZD27C200PHRUG is packaged in a compact, surface-mount package, making it suitable for integration into various electronic devices. Its essence lies in providing reliable voltage regulation and transient voltage suppression in a small form factor.

The BZD27C200PHRUG operates based on Zener diode principles, where it maintains a constant voltage across its terminals by conducting in the reverse-biased direction when the voltage exceeds the specified threshold.
